Default Manu-matic

This is what the guy called my Auto Trans..... When is the best time to shift to "S"......Can I use at all times??? What about MPG?

You should be able to use it all the time, so long a you don't redline too often.


Expect the MPG to be the same. I have been using it alot whenever I am driving around town. The auto usually shifts way over 3k rpms. Anytime I'm tooling around town, I'll use the "s" and shift around 2500 to try and increase MPG. Haven't really paid attention to whether it's working.

So if i'm doing 50 and shift to "S"........What will happen???

Assuming you are cruising at 50, when you shift to "S" the transmission will shift out of 4th (overdrive) into 3rd. From there you can up/downshift through each gear sequentially.
